グローバル教養科目(Chemistry for a Sustainable World)

Chemistry for a Sustainable World
Our continued existence on Earth depends on human activities, which are sometimes complex and
involve the identification and manipulation of natural and non-natural substances for our benefit. This course will introduce students to the development and application of the chemical principles and practices that are aimed at maintaining a safe and sustainable environment. Notably, students will be expected to understand the basic principles of environmentally friendly chemical processes as well as the environmental, political, and social factors driving these processes. Furthermore, students will be required to discuss the applicability and application of metrics for assessing chemical processes. 授業計画
The topics that will be covered include: Waste prevention Efficient synthesis Safe synthesis Safe products Minimal use of auxiliaries Efficient energy Renewable feedstocks Minimal use of protecting groups Catalysis Degradable or Recoverable Real-time analysis Accident prevention
